Sonic238 Posted January 30, 2006 Author Share Posted January 30, 2006 here's a solution as far as i got: level 1 just click on the monitor to get to the email field level 2 the words "open" and "email" are italic. you have to change the adress from .../email.htm to .../openemail.htm and hit enter. level 3 the hint is "too much sourcecode for today". if you look into the source code there is a comment line <!--enterthegate--> you have to change the .../openemail.htm to .../enterthegate.htm level 4 this thing is a pyramid. so change the adress to pyramid.htm like you did before. level 5 in the sourcecode there is another hint: <!--bridge--> these are the letters in html. so on a windows pc you type in in word ALT+98 will give you the letter "b". this results in the word bridge. adress: bridge.htm level 6 is where i am stuck if you change the adress to paper.htm there is another thing but i don't get it.
